Output 84a09b825c60bef898db28bb9f1da3744b539c894f6e0c25ef6d80a178802b36:0

value
517928809
script pubkey
OP_0 OP_PUSHBYTES_20 d7112b8aa3840cc4ea5399f96f44c3b62bee8422
address
bc1q6ugjhz4rssxvf6jnn8uk73xrkc47appzaflqdp
transaction
84a09b825c60bef898db28bb9f1da3744b539c894f6e0c25ef6d80a178802b36
confirmations
89081
spent
true